**Caution:** If this command results in an error messages, the message can contain a secret value provided in the request. Make sure that these errors are not visible to others.
|
||||
{% admonition type="warning" name="Caution" %}If this command results in an error messages, the message can contain a secret value provided in the request. Make sure that these errors are not visible to others.{% /admonition %}
|
||||
|
||||
* Do not write this error to a log file that can be seen by multiple people.
|
||||
* Do not paste this error to a public place for debugging.
